> > Yeah, that was my though also. I just redid those steps with somebody
> > who is a bit familiar with Linux looking over my shoulder. Same results,
> > volume 210 does not come online. I can however use the chccwdev to bring
> > 210 online after the boot.
>
> When you ran mkinitrd, was the 210 volume online at that point?  If not, try 
> mkinitrd and zipl while it is online.

It may help to run mkinitrd with -v to show verbose output.  You should
see a line similar to:

adding dasd_mod with options dasd=200-201,210

If it does say this, can you paste the output of zipl -V?
